How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Warson Woods?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Warson Woods Studio Apartments | $1,821 | $1,806 | $1,836 |
| Warson Woods 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,903 | $1,175 | $2,997 |
| Warson Woods 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,674 | $1,223 | $3,921 |
| Warson Woods 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,457 | $4,301 | $4,586 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Warson Woods
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Warson Woods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Warson Woods ranges from $1,175 to $2,997 with an average monthly rent of $1,903.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Warson Woods c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Warson Woods range from $1,223 to $3,921.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,674.
